How much do plumbers cost in Lambeth?

The cost of hiring a plumber in Lambeth typically ranges from £40 to £80 per hour, depending on the complexity of the job and the time required. Here's a comparison of typical plumbing jobs in the area:

Job typeTypical cost in LambethTime
Fixing a leaking tapĀ£50–£901–2 hours
Installing a new boilerĀ£1,500–£2,5001–2 days
Unblocking a drainĀ£80–£1201–3 hours
Bathroom refurbishmentĀ£3,000–£7,0001–2 weeks

What to look for in a plumber

Selecting the right plumber is essential for ensuring quality work.

  • Qualifications: Look for plumbers with NVQ Level 2 or 3, City & Guilds, and Gas Safe registration for gas-related services.
  • Insurance: Ensure they have public liability insurance of at least Ā£1 million.
  • Reviews: Check online reviews and ask for references to gauge their reliability and service quality.
  • Local knowledge: Experience with Lambeth's specific challenges, such as dealing with heritage building materials or urban water pressure issues, is a plus.

Do I need planning permission for plumbing work in Lambeth?
Generally, internal plumbing work does not require planning permission. However, if you're in a listed building or conservation area, you may need consent for significant changes.
